Pine Nut Crusted Salmon

Serves 2 | Prep Time | Cook Time

Why I Love This Recipe

In my many trial and errors and experiments, I have discovered that food processed Chex Mix makes for GREAT bread crumbs! This discovery I must credit to my husband, who was looking into the pantry with me one day while we tried to figure out how to magically acquire breadcrumbs with no bread in the house. I also like "nut crusted" fish dishes. So I used some pine nuts and the chex mix as a topping for salmon. It was a success!


Ingredients You'll Need

salmon per person (toss around in lemon juice and olive oil, salt, pepper)
1/2 cup pine nuts
1 garlic clove
3 basil leaves
1/2 cup chex mix (or seasoned bread crumbs)


Directions

In food processor, blend ingredients. Bake salmon on cookie sheet at 400 degrees for 5 minutes, until color changes to lighter pink. Press blended nut crust on top of salmon. Finish in oven 5 minutes or until desired 'doneness'.
